How the Treasury Works
Every time a transaction is processed on the Cardano blockchain, a small percentage of the transaction fee is directed into the Treasury. This ensures a continuous flow of funds that can be used to support the ecosystem. The exact percentage of fees going into the Treasury is determined by the Cardano protocol and can be adjusted through on-chain governance mechanisms.
The allocation of these funds is managed through a process known as “Treasury Voting.” Community members, particularly those who hold and stake ADA (Cardano’s native cryptocurrency), can participate in voting processes to decide how the funds should be distributed. This democratic approach ensures that the community has a direct say in the direction of the project, aligning with Cardano’s commitment to decentralization and open governance.

What is the Cardano Treasury?
The Cardano Treasury is a fund that is continuously replenished through a portion of the block rewards generated by the network. Specifically, a percentage of each block reward is directed into the treasury, creating a self-sustaining financial mechanism. This fund is used to finance proposals submitted by developers, researchers, and other members of the Cardano community who wish to contribute to the platform’s growth and innovation.
Funding Mechanism
The way the treasury is funded is an essential part of its design. In the Cardano protocol, a fixed percentage of the block reward—currently set at 20%—is automatically sent to the treasury. This means that as the network grows and more blocks are mined, the treasury receives a consistent and growing amount of funds. This mechanism ensures that the treasury remains well-funded over time, allowing for ongoing investment in the ecosystem.
Proposal Submission and Voting Process
To access the funds in the treasury, individuals or organizations must submit a proposal through the Cardano Governance System. These proposals can cover a wide range of initiatives, such as software development, research projects, marketing efforts, or community-building activities. Once a proposal is submitted, it undergoes a voting process where stakeholders (i.e., ADA holders) can cast their votes using their stake in the network.
The voting process is conducted through a series of on-chain referendums, ensuring transparency and fairness. Proposals that receive sufficient support from the community are approved, and the corresponding funds are released to the proposer. This democratic approach allows the Cardano community to have a direct say in how the treasury is used, reinforcing the decentralized nature of the platform.

1. Segregated Witness (SegWit)
SegWit is a protocol enhancement introduced to the Bitcoin network in 2017. It separates (or “segregates”) the signature data from the transaction data, which reduces the size of each transaction. This improvement increases the block capacity without changing the block size limit, thereby improving scalability and reducing transaction fees. SegWit also helps mitigate the risk of transaction malleability, a vulnerability that could alter transaction IDs and cause issues with smart contracts and other dependent systems.
2. Lightning Network
The Lightning Network is a second-layer protocol built on top of the Bitcoin blockchain. It enables instant, low-cost transactions by creating off-chain payment channels between users. This protocol enhancement significantly improves Bitcoin’s scalability and usability for everyday transactions, making it more viable as a medium of exchange rather than just a store of value.
3. Ethereum’s EIP-1559
EIP-1559 was a major protocol enhancement introduced on the Ethereum blockchain in 2021. It redesigned the fee structure by introducing a base fee that is burned rather than given to miners. This change aimed to make transaction fees more predictable and reduce volatility in gas prices. It also contributed to Ethereum’s transition toward a more deflationary model, potentially increasing the long-term value of ETH.
4. zk-Rollups
zk-Rollups are a type of Layer 2 scaling solution that uses zero-knowledge proofs to batch multiple transactions into a single proof, which is then verified on the main blockchain. This protocol enhancement significantly increases throughput while maintaining the security of the underlying blockchain. Projects like ZKSync and StarkWare have leveraged zk-Rollups to enable high-speed, low-cost transactions on Ethereum and other blockchains.
5. Ethereum Merge
The Ethereum Merge, completed in September 2022, was a major protocol enhancement that transitioned the Ethereum network from a proof-of-work (PoW) consensus mechanism to a proof-of-stake (PoS) model. This shift improved energy efficiency, reduced environmental impact, and laid the groundwork for future scalability upgrades such as sharding and further Layer 2 solutions. The Merge also increased the security of the network by making 51% attacks economically unfeasible for attackers.
6. Solana’s Tower BFT Consensus
Solana introduced a unique consensus mechanism called Tower BFT, which combines elements of Proof of Stake with a Proof of History (PoH) timekeeping system. This protocol enhancement allows Solana to achieve extremely high throughput (thousands of transactions per second) while maintaining fast finality. Tower BFT helps Solana scale efficiently and support complex decentralized applications (dApps) and Web3 services.
7. Polkadot’s Cross-Chain Communication
Polkadot is designed to enable interoperability between different blockchains through its relay chain and parachain architecture. Protocol enhancements such as cross-chain message passing and shared security allow parachains to communicate and share data securely. This innovation makes Polkadot a powerful platform for building a multi-chain ecosystem where different blockchains can work together seamlessly.

Governance Models and Decision-Making
The answer to this question depends largely on the governance model of the project. There are generally two main types of governance structures: centralized and decentralized.
Centralized Governance
In a centralized governance model, a small group of individuals—often the core development team, founders, or a designated council—has the authority to make decisions about the use of treasury funds. This approach can be efficient, as it allows for quick decision-making without the need for broad consensus. However, it also raises concerns about transparency, accountability, and potential conflicts of interest.
Decentralized Governance
On the other hand, decentralized governance models empower the community by allowing token holders to vote on key decisions, including the allocation of treasury funds. In this structure, proposals are typically submitted by members of the community or developers, and then voted on by token holders. The weight of each vote often corresponds to the number of tokens held, ensuring that those with a larger stake in the project have more influence over its direction.
Examples of Treasury Management in Popular Projects
Several well-known blockchain projects have implemented different approaches to treasury management:
Uniswap: Uniswap’s treasury is managed through a decentralized autonomous organization (DAO), where UNI token holders can propose and vote on spending proposals. This ensures that the community has a direct say in how funds are allocated. Aave: Aave uses a DAO-based governance model, where AAVE token holders can submit and vote on proposals related to the protocol’s development, including treasury usage. MakerDAO: MakerDAO employs a multi-layered governance system, where MKR token holders can vote on major decisions, including the allocation of the Dai Savings Rate and treasury expenditures.

Cardano Community Funding Proposal Questions and Answers
Common User Questions About the Cardano Community Funding Proposal
Question 1: What is the purpose of the $71 million funding proposal?
Answer 1: The $71 million funding proposal is intended to support a one-year upgrade plan for the Cardano blockchain, led by core developer Input Output Engineering (IOE). This upgrade aims to enhance the platform’s functionality and scalability.
Question 2: Who approved the funding proposal?
Answer 2: The Cardano community approved the funding proposal. The decision was made through a voting process, with 74% of voters supporting the initiative.
Question 3: How will the funds be distributed?
Answer 3: The $71 million in ADA (approximately 96 million ADA) will be disbursed from the Cardano treasury on a milestone basis. This means the funds will be released in stages as specific development goals are achieved.
Question 4: Who is overseeing the distribution of the funds?
Answer 4: The distribution of the funds will be overseen by Intersect, an independent organization that ensures transparency and accountability in how the funds are used.
